1. Engineering Overview: Redefining Seed Population Control
In the realm of precision agriculture, the Variable Rate Drive (VRD) gearbox—often referred to in the industry as the Zero-Max style drive—is the central nervous system of a high-performance planter. Unlike traditional fixed-ratio gearboxes, our ever-power VRD systems allow for instantaneous, infinitesimal adjustments to the seeding rate without stopping the tractor. This capability is critical for variable-rate prescriptions based on soil conductivity maps and GPS data.
From a mechanical perspective, the VRD transforms the constant input speed from the tractor’s Ground Drive or Hydraulic motor into a precise, modulated output that dictates the rotation of the seed meter. Our engineering team at ever-power has focused on eliminating “seeding gaps” by perfecting the internal link-and-clutch mechanism, ensuring that even at high speeds, the seed spacing remains consistent within a 1% margin of error.

3. Anatomical Breakdown: How the VRD Drives Your Planter
The Core Mechanism
O ever-power Variable Rate Gearbox operates on the principle of a reciprocating linkage system. The input shaft drives a series of eccentric cams. These cams, in turn, oscillate connecting rods that engage with one-way over-running clutches on the output shaft. By adjusting the “stroke” of these rods via a control lever (or electronic actuator), the output rotation speed is precisely controlled from zero to maximum.
System Integration
In a typical Dutch potato planter or a UK wheat seeder, the gearbox sits between the ground wheel (the master drive) and the seed plate. It acts as the “multiplier.” If the GPS sensor detects a soil zone with higher moisture holding capacity, the actuator moves the gearbox lever, increasing the seeding rate instantly without the driver ever touching a gear shift.

Q2: What are the signs that my planter gearbox needs immediate replacement?
A: Look for three critical “Red Flags”: 1) Irregular seed spacing (indicates linkage wear), 2) Heat buildup over 80°C (indicates bearing failure), and 3) “Slop” or play in the input shaft (indicates internal spline erosion). If you see metal flakes in the oil, replace it immediately to avoid total field downtime.

Q4: Does the VRD gearbox require a specific type of lubrication for high-speed operation?
A: For high-speed precision seeding, we mandate a Full Synthetic SAE 75W-90 oil with GL-5 extreme pressure additives. This ensures the internal one-way clutches don’t “slip” under high-frequency oscillations typical of 12km/h+ speeds.
